Elkhart teen charged with armed robbery

Photo supplied / https://pixabay.com/images/id-6485824/

One of two Elkhart teens charged with armed robbery pleaded guilty.

17-year-old Keondre Harris, along with Elijah Coleman, allegedly used a gun to hold up another teenage victim and steal cash outside the Sunny Side Food Mart in Elkhart on March 23.

The Goshen News says Harris is charged with armed robbery and a misdemeanor count of resisting law enforcement, and his sentencing is set for June 20.
